Celebrating Milestones in Open Source AI

The J.A.R.V.I.S project, developed by a college student, is a prime example of how open-source initiatives can inspire and engage a community. This voice assistant incorporates numerous features, ranging from dynamic authentication using optical face recognition to weather reporting and even YouTube downloading capabilities. Its success on platforms like GitHub highlights the importance of community-driven projects in the tech landscape, where contributors can share their insights and enhance functionalities collaboratively.

The open-source model not only democratizes access to technology but also accelerates innovation. As developers worldwide contribute to projects like J.A.R.V.I.S, the collective intelligence and creativity foster advancements that might not be possible in isolated environments. This spirit of collaboration is echoed in NVIDIA's recent developments, which integrate generative AI into computer graphics and everyday applications.

The Generative AI Boom: Bridging Graphics and Intelligence

NVIDIA's recent keynote at SIGGRAPH 2023 showcased how generative AI is reshaping the landscape of computer graphics. By combining ray tracing technology with AI, NVIDIA has pioneered breakthroughs in rendering, allowing for real-time graphics that were previously unimaginable. The introduction of products like the Grace Hopper processor signifies a shift toward accelerated computing, enabling vast improvements in AI processing capabilities.

Generative AI, characterized by its ability to create content based on learned patterns from extensive datasets, is revolutionizing various sectors. For instance, companies are leveraging generative models to automate tasks traditionally performed by humans, from creating realistic 3D environments to generating code snippets for developers. This paradigm shift empowers users to harness AI's potential without needing extensive technical expertise, as natural language becomes the new programming language.

The Role of Omniverse in Industrial Transformation

NVIDIA's Omniverse is a platform that integrates multiple tools and applications, enabling seamless collaboration across industries. By adopting OpenUSD as the foundation, Omniverse facilitates the creation of complex 3D environments and simulations that are crucial for industries such as automotive manufacturing, architecture, and entertainment.

For example, automotive companies like BMW and Mercedes are using Omniverse to digitalize their workflows, allowing them to simulate production lines and autonomous vehicles before physical construction begins. This digital twin technology not only reduces costs and time but also minimizes errors and enhances productivity.

The implications of such technology extend to various sectors, including construction, where teams can collaborate on designs in real time, significantly reducing the time required for project completion. As more companies adopt these tools, the potential for innovation and efficiency increases exponentially.
